North Atlantic Treaty Organization agreements

NATO is an alliance of 32 member countries from North America and Europe. This membership gives Canadian organizations the opportunity to bid on NATO procurement initiatives.

NATO clearances for organizations

Organizations bidding on NATO opportunities must meet the NATO security requirements listed in the procurement documents.

NATO facility security clearance (FSC) gives access, at the appropriate security level, to information and assets to the level of:

  • NATO Confidential
  • NATO Secret
  • Control of Secret Material in an International Command (COSMIC) Top SecretFootnote 1

NATO personnel security clearance

Once your organization is granted a NATO FSC, you need to request NATO personnel security clearances for employees to gain access to NATO classified information and assets.

Who is eligible

Once your organization is granted a NATO FSC, you can request NATO personnel security clearances for employees who are:

  • citizens of Canada or permanent residents
  • citizens of other NATO countries (the CSP will coordinate with the DSA of that country)
  • citizens of non-NATO countries at NATO Confidential or Secret clearance level, on a case-by-case basis

How personnel get a NATO clearance

Organizations that have obtained the required NATO FSC can request NATO personnel security clearance for their employees. Once the Canadian personnel security clearance has been granted, the CSP will send you a NATO security briefing form to be completed and signed by the company security officer and the employee. Once approved, the employee is considered NATO security cleared, with access to NATO information and assets respecting the need-to-know principle.
